Chevrolet Trailblazer 2005: The Weekly Driver Review

With the addition of the 5.3-liter, 325-horsepower V8 extended cab (EXT), eight Chevrolet Trailblazer models are on the road in 2005. And as the largest and most powerful Blazer available, the new EXT has plenty to offer.It's comfortable and provides a confident drive. It offers vast cargo space, has an attractive two-tone interior, a well-designed console and boasts of plenty of impressive option packages.But sometimes subtle qualities or subtle deficiencies are more impressive or problematic than a vehicle's overt characteristics.So it is with the new Blazer. While recently showing the car to several friends, one sat in the second row of seats. Surprisingly, his head easily hit the roof.

My friend is 6-foot-3, and while that's tall, he's not a giant by any stretch."I've got a Scion and there's plenty of rear seat headroom," my friend commented.The quick analysis made a good point. As the largest and most powerful Blazer available, shouldn't a 6-foot-3 person sit comfortably in the middle of the car's three rows?Conversely, an SUV hardly seems like a vehicle for a remarkable sound system. But the Bose premium sound system available in the Blazer's Sun, Sound and Entertainment Package is superior. The combination AM/FM stereo, six-disc changer, XM satellite radio and eight speakers are arguably the finest music package I've experienced in any test car in the past two years.Beyond a curious space limitation and a wondrous sound system options, the Blazer offers an odd mixture. It's a well-designed SUV with plenty of space for family and cargo.

It has adequate steering and handling, and it offers a quiet ride considering its status as a large SUV with 17-inch tires.Yet, the Blazer falls short in other key areas.The vehicle's braking system seems uneven - fine in some circumstances, soft in other scenarios with far-too-long response time. The Blazer maneuvers well in traffic and its turning radius is surprisingly tight and efficient. But again, for each of the vehicle's strengths, there's a weakness. The Blazer's fuel rating of 14 mpg (city) and 19 (hwy) is hardly impressive.Standard features are adequate: power mirrors, heated daytime running lamps, remote keyless entry, tinted rear glass, 65/35 second and third-row folding seats and a rear window defogger, among other standard items.Three options packages, the aforementioned Sun, Sound and Entertainment, as well as the Luxury and V8 Power Play packages, can add nearly $7,000 to the base sticker, pushing the total price to more than $41,000.Some options are worthwhile, including the OnStar Emergency System (with one year of free service) and leather-appointed seats. Other options ? cruise control, leather-wrapped steering wheel and steering wheel audio controls ? are standard for other manufacturers' SUVs.A Preferred Equipment Savings reduction of $3,150 lowers the top-of-the line Blazer's price, after a $685 destination charge, to $38,515.As such, the Blazer isn't the most expensive or most economical SUV on the market.

But certainly, for nearly $40,000, good brakes and sufficient second-row headroom shouldn't be issues.2005 Chevrolet TrailblazerSafety features -- Dual-stage driver and front passenger airbags. Antilock brakes.Fuel Mileage (estimates) -- 14 mpg (city), 19 mpg (highway).Warranty -- Bumper to bumper, 3 years/36,000 miles; Power train, 3 years/36,000 miles; Corrosion, 6 years/100,000 miles; 24-hour free roadside assistance, 3 years, 36,000 milesBase price -- $34,270.00.

Toyota Corolla: Still One of America?s Most Trusted Cars


A carryover from the previous year, 2005, the 2006 Toyota Corolla is a four-door, 5-passenger family sedan, or sports sedan. It is made available in four trims, which ranges from the CE to the XRS. When this vehicle was introduced, the CE has been equipped with a standard 1.8 liter, I4, 126-horsepower engine that has the capability to achieve 32-mpg when in the city, and 41-mpg if driving on the highway. Standard for the line is a 5-speed manual transmission with overdrive, however, a 4-speed automatic transmission with drive is optional. For the XRS, this trim has been equipped with a standard 1.8 liter, I4, 164-horsepower engine that is able to attain 26-mpg during city driving and 34-mpg while on the highway.

Standard for this trim is the 6-speed manual transmission with overdrive.

Driving To Savings: Car Tips To Save You Money

Although the most interesting method to save on car operating costs came from my chemistry teacher in high school (Buy your gasoline in the early morning or at night when it is cold outside. Gas becomes denser in cooler temperatures. Since gas pumps only measure the volume of fuel - not the density - you'll get better overall gas mileage for your money by purchasing fuel when it's cool outside rather than in the heat of the day), the moment that will determine the true amount you can save on your car costs comes before you even buy a car. The simple fact is that the type of car you decide to purchase will have the largest impact on the expenses you incur during the lifetime of it.Even if a large sports utility vehicle is your dream car, it's probably a lot more than you really need. Taking some time to make a list of the things you'll use the car for will help determine the difference between your true needs and your wants.
